So, I bought this on a whim after dinner with my friend Jen, and I just ordered 2 additional shades. Benefit Cosmentics Creaseless Cream Eyeshadow, $19--this little pot is going to last forever. Colors I have, Tattle Tale, Get Figgy, and Busy Signal.

This is the expensive one on my list. It is like a Sconicare toothbrush for your face--and it is amazing. I have the one-speed version, the Mia, in pink. The brush heads need replacing every 6 months or so and you re-charge the handle every couple weeks--works in the shower too! $149.

Amazing--gets all the dead, yucky skin off! Made from recycled polyester and is washable. Best thing, the price, $4 for 2 towels. Way better than the puff.
